The LA City engineers' contract calls for an important Joint Initiative for Maximizing Engineering Efficiency ("JIMEE") committee. Committee members monitor city engineering contracts, review contracting-out processes, identify inefficiencies and propose solutions to the City Council. The committee is made up of two representatives from MOU 8, two representatives from MOU 17, four representatives from management and one representative from the CAO's office.
